Yarn

Yarn was my Capstone Project at Lakeshore Technical College. I utilized Bootstrap 4 and Laravel 5.7 to build a server-side rendered application to allow users to read and write interactive stories with multiple paths (inspired by Bandersnatch on Netflix). Additionally, I created a simple API within the Laravel application to allow consumption of the stories in a companion mobile app that I created with Ionic and Angular 7. As it was a learning PHP project done in school, it is not deployed, but I may continue development in the future. In the meantime, you may check out an overview in the following video.

ArachniCMS

ArachniCMS was my first major project on my own after leaving LTC. This is intended to be a generic CMS product for use by individuals or small organizations. I stuck with Laravel 5.8 as well as a server-side rendering paradigm like I had used for my Capstone Project, and in the process I learned a lot about polymorphic model relationships, various Laravel ecosystem packages (such as numerous packages by Spatie that can be used for such things as backups, RSS feeds, and even integrations with third party services like Mailgun and MailChimp), jobs and queues, advanced templating with Laravel's Blade system and Tailwind CSS, and manual deployment via git to an Ubuntu VPS. Although I won't be continuing development, it is open source, and the most stable version so far is the v1.3.6 tag. For an extensive video overview:
